Originally Posted by cav1429
my 09 ultra pops during decel quick question i checked closed throttle position with my lap top thats ok it was 0% then i wanted to add 10"s in the fuel map colum how do i do this to the left of the screen there is a table one and table two for both cyclinders.i click on table one then add 10'S in the 0 colum from 1750 to 5000 do thesame for table two then what do i do
Yes, you will add 10's to both fuel table 1 and 2 in the 0% column from 1750-5000 RPM's and when finished hit send map which will send the map to the PC-V unit.

Originally Posted by bpez317
Kind of related but won't help you any with your question...I don't get anything in the middle of my screen...it's just blank. Everything else seems fine. How'd you get the table to come up? My PCV came loaded with a map so I didn't download anything. Did the table come up when you turned it on or did you have to click on something?
Thanks for any help and sorry for jumping in like this...
The main center screen remains blank in the PC-V software until you pick a table on the the left which gives you the options fuel 1&2, igntion, and if you have AT enabled an AFR table as well
